Due to an unfortunate accident while biking with friends, I was dealt a serious injury. I received an acquired brain injury, leaving me disabled. I want to increase awareness of an acquired brain injury. As a member of the PARTY Program (Prevent Alcohol and Risk-related Trauma in Youth, http://www.partyprogram.com/), I'm giving a monthly presentation at the hospital to high school students about bicycle safety, and alcohol-related accidents. Also, I organized Conquer Acquired Brain Injury, a world-wide walk that will happen in the month of June, in countries including Australia, Belgium, Scotland, Spain, US, and multiple sites in Canada. I am trying to raise awareness, around the world, of an acquired brain injury. The reason for the month of June is because Ottawa's mayor declared the month of June as Ottawa's "brain injury awareness month.
